A STUNNING VILLAGE PROPERTY SET IN APPROX. SIX ACRES WITH A DETACHED FOUR BEDROOM HOUSE, SEPARATE ANNEXE, SUPERB EQUESTRIAN FACILITIES AND GOOD QUALITY PADDOCKS, WITH AN UNRIVALLED AND UNEXPECTED OUTLOOK ACROSS WAVERING DOWN AND THE WEST MENDIP WAY

? Detached Village House with Four Bedrooms, Three Reception Rooms
and Three Bathrooms
? Separate Detached One Bedroom Annexe
? Stable Yard with Four Loose Boxes and Stores
? Manège 40m x 20m
? Post and Railed Paddocks
? Access to Extensive Walking and Hacking on Wavering Down
? Approx. 6 Acres In All

A stunning village property set in approx. six acres with a detached four bedroom house, separate annexe, superb equestrian facilities and good quality paddocks, with an unrivalled and unexpected outlook across Wavering Down and the West Mendip Way

The main house is understood to date back to 1946 and it provides a spacious and comfortable family home with benefit of a separate detached annexe which was converted from a former double garage in 2013. The current owners created the comprehensive equestrian environment, designed to take full advantage of the property’s wonderful location, with access to many miles of spectacular outriding over Wavering Down, which is owned by the National Trust and is designated as an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ty.
